Runbook: account recovery — Confignal hot-reload service

1. Verify user identity per standard support flow.
2. Check hot-reload daemon status; a locked account blocks config pushes but reloads of cached configs continue.
3. Reset the account from the admin panel. Do NOT restart the daemon mid-reload.
4. Re-issue the reload token after reset.
5. If the admin panel itself is locked out, unseal it using the recovery passphrase:

unlock words, hahip-baduf: holwyn-istath-julvan

## Snapshot Testing — Brindlekit UI

Support often gets asked why a release was delayed by "snapshot failures." Our UI components are compared against stored reference renders; any pixel or markup drift blocks merge until a developer approves the change. Approved snapshots and their history live in a shared database so you can look up when a component last changed. You can query it using the connection below.

replica DSN, yahog-kawig: redis://istox_svc:um@db-8a67.halixforge.test:5432/frawyn

Handover note — Crumbwheel order cutoffs.

Welcome aboard. The bakery cutoff rule in Crumbwheel closes same-day orders at 14:00 local to each storefront, not UTC — this has bitten us twice. Holiday overrides live in the calendar service and take precedence silently, so always check there first when a cutoff looks wrong. To unlock the calendar service's admin console after a restart, enter the recovery passphrase below.

vault phrase of bagap-bahaf = silion-pelox-sorox-casdor-quenwyn-fraax-eliox-praael-kelion-quenvan-kasox-rusael-norius-belvan

## Deploying the Gatewick Proctor Queue

Deploys are pretty painless: push to main, wait for the pipeline, then watch the queue drain dashboard for five minutes. If candidates pile up mid-exam, roll back first and ask questions later — the queue replays safely. Everything the workers care about lives in one config block, shown here for reference.

settings of bafof-yagef:
JOROX_PIN=8740
JOROX_TENANT=pelox
JOROX_METRICS_HOST=metrics.jorox.qorvelworks.internal
JOROX_SEAL=seal_c78f63c1
JOROX_STANDBY_TEAM=norax